Fleet Fuel Reporting — Account Recovery. When a depot manager at Harlowe Transit loses access to the FuelLedger dashboard, first verify their identity against the depot roster, then reset their session tokens from the admin panel. If the reporting vault itself is sealed (rare, usually after a failed migration), escalate to tier two and unseal it manually. That unseal step requires the recovery passphrase noted below.

vault phrase of bagaf-kajeg = jorath-feniel-briir-siliel-ralix

## Data Stores: Consent Banner Rollout

Quick note for the weekly sync: the Bramblewick consent banner is now live on 40% of traffic. Opt-in events land in the `consent_events` table on the Pindrop cluster, so don't panic if row counts spike. Dashboards refresh hourly. If you need to poke at the raw data, connect using the string below.

replica DSN, kajep-yahag: mssql://praok_svc:iF@db-8d68.plorvaio.local:5432/eliion

**Q: How do we do schema migrations with zero downtime?**

Short version: on Ledgerline we never do destructive changes in one go. Add the new column, dual-write from the app, backfill in batches, flip reads, then drop the old column a release later. The migration runner, Stoneskip, enforces this order and refuses risky DDL. To run it against staging you'll need to unlock the migration vault first. Its recovery passphrase is:

vault phrase of kawep-tahog = ulaix-briath